AT1G11720.1

Model type
Protein coding
Short Description
starch synthase 3
Curator Summary
Encodes a starch synthase that in addition to its role in starch biosynthesis also has a negative regulatory function in the biosynthesis of transient starch. The protein apparently contains a starch-binding domain (SBD).
Computational Description
starch synthase 3 (SS3); FUNCTIONS IN: starch synthase activity, transferase activity, transferring glycosyl groups; INVOLVED IN: starch biosynthetic process; LOCATED IN: chloroplast; EXPRESSED IN: 23 plant structures; EXPRESSED DURING: 13 growth stages; CONTAINS InterPro DOMAIN/s: Glycogen/starch synthases, ADP-glucose type (InterPro:IPR011835), Starch synthase, catalytic domain (InterPro:IPR013534), Glycosyl transferase, group 1 (InterPro:IPR001296), Carbohydrate binding domain, family 25 (InterPro:IPR005085); BEST Arabidopsis thaliana protein match is: starch synthase 4 (TAIR:AT4G18240.1); Has 8453 Blast hits to 8330 proteins in 2963 species: Archae - 164; Bacteria - 3762; Metazoa - 19; Fungi - 103; Plants - 3720; Viruses - 1; Other Eukaryotes - 684 (source: NCBI BLink).
